🍕 1. Bring Your Own Bottle (and Snacks!)

Gone are the days of playing bartender for everyone. Make it simple — tell your mates to bring their favourite drink or a snack to share. You’ll end up with a great mix of drinks, new flavours to try, and you’ll save yourself a small fortune.

💡 Boozah tip: Turn it into a mini cocktail challenge — everyone brings one random mixer and one spirit. Mix and match to see who can create the best (or worst!) DIY drink.

🪜 Shots’n Ladders

Like snakes and ladders… but with a boozy twist!

How to Play:

  1. Setup: Fill the four Boozah Cups and place them on the white Boozah logos at the top of the board. Fill the six Boozah Shot Glasses and position them on the black Boozah logos along the sides.

  2. Start the Game: Each player picks a Boozah Game Piece and places it on “Start.” Roll the dice to see who goes first.

  3. Gameplay: Take turns rolling the dice and moving your piece.

    • Land on a ladder → climb up

    • Land on a snake → slide down

    • Land on a pint → take a sip

    • Land on a shot → take a shot!

  4. Winning: The first player to reach the finish wins.

Battle Shots

A Boozah spin on the classic Battleships — tactical, boozy, and brilliant.

How to Play:

  1. Setup: Each side places an agreed number of shots or drinks on any numbers of their choosing.

  2. Starting the Game: Players take turns rolling two dice.

  3. Gameplay: If the total matches a number with an opponent’s shot, they drink that shot!

  4. Special Rule: The Boozah ghost on square “1” is for doubles — if you roll a double and there’s a shot on the ghost, you must drink it.

  5. Winning: The first to clear all of their opponent’s shots takes the crown.

🍸 4. Mix Simple, Cheap Drinks

You don’t need a full bar to make great drinks. Here are three quick ideas using things you probably already have:

  • Gin + Lemonade + Fresh Lime → easy and refreshing.

  • Rum + Cola + Dash of Lime Juice → a classic with zing.

  • Vodka + Squash + Soda Water → cheap, cheerful, and surprisingly tasty.

💡 Boozah tip: Freeze leftover fruit and use it as ice — it looks fancy and saves buying mixers later.

📺 5. Add a Theme for Extra Laughs

A theme doesn’t have to mean costumes (though, why not?). Try:

  • “Dress Like Your 2000s Self”

  • “Pub Olympics” night — each round is a different Boozah game

  • “Fake Fancy” — everyone wears something over-the-top and brings a posh-sounding cocktail

Themes make even the cheapest night feel like a full event.
